What Does a Remote Full Stack Developer Do?

As a remote full stack developer, you work from home to create back-end and front-end code for software, websites, and other technology applications. Your responsibilities include developing website architecture, helping to create a website application, developing and designing APIs, and ensuring that applications have the right level of responsiveness. Common duties associated with this job include working on a database or server to ensure functionality, creating web design features by working with graphic designers, helping to transform a concept into a finished product, and staying updated with the latest programming languages and web applications.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Full Stack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Full Stack Developer, you need strong proficiency in both front-end and back-end programming languages (such as JavaScript, Python, or Java), web frameworks, and a solid understanding of database management. Familiarity with version control systems (like Git), cloud platforms, and CI/CD pipelines is typically required, along with relevant certifications such as AWS Certified Developer or Microsoft Azure certifications. Excellent communication, self-motivation, and time management skills are essential for collaborating across distributed teams and managing independent workloads. These competencies enable developers to build robust, scalable applications efficiently while maintaining productivity and effective teamwork in a remote environment.

How do Remote Full Stack Developers typically collaborate with team members across different time zones?

Remote Full Stack Developers often work with colleagues located around the globe, making strong communication skills and adaptability essential. Teams usually rely on collaboration tools like Slack, Jira, and GitHub to track progress, discuss features, and conduct code reviews asynchronously. Regular virtual meetings are scheduled to accommodate time zone differences, and clear documentation helps ensure everyone stays aligned. Successful developers in this environment are proactive about providing updates and clarifying requirements to keep projects on track.

What is a Remote Full Stack Developer?

A Remote Full Stack Developer is a software professional who works from a location outside of a traditional office, building and maintaining both the front-end (client-side) and back-end (server-side) components of web applications. They are skilled in a variety of programming languages and frameworks, enabling them to handle the full technology stack required for web development. Working remotely, they collaborate with teams using digital tools, manage code repositories, and often participate in virtual meetings to ensure project goals are met efficiently.

What is the difference between Remote Full Stack Developer vs Remote Front End Developer?

AspectRemote Full Stack DeveloperRemote Front End Developer
Required SkillsProficiency in both front-end and back-end technologies (e.g., JavaScript, HTML, CSS, Node.js, databases)Specialized in front-end technologies (e.g., HTML, CSS, JavaScript, frameworks like React or Angular)
Work EnvironmentTypically handles both client-side and server-side tasks, often in full project cyclesFocuses on user interface and experience, collaborating closely with designers and back-end developers
Common UsageUsed across startups, tech companies, and agencies requiring versatile developersPopular in UI/UX design firms, front-end agencies, and companies emphasizing user experience

The main difference is that a Remote Full Stack Developer manages both front-end and back-end development, offering a broader skill set, while a Remote Front End Developer specializes in creating engaging user interfaces. Your choice depends on whether you prefer a full-spectrum development role or a focus on user-facing features.
